Far Cry 2 Multiplayer - The Lowdown

After a recent interview with Gamespot, its fair to say that we know alot more about the Multiplayer section of Far Cry 2. After reading, i have learned how 'Capture the diamonds' and 'Uprising' work. I have also learned more about the gameplay. It is clear now that Far Cry 2's gameplay is a gentle blend of both Call of Duty 4, and Battlefield Bad Company. The number of classes, way of unlocking weapons and healing are all very similar to Battlefield, whereas weapon pickups, weapon upgrades and low health count on people are much closer to home with Call of Duty.

There is also a capability to heal dead teammates, like Gears of War.
